Johnson & Johnson's Caplyta Gains FDA Approval for Depression

Story summary
- Johnson & Johnson (the company) received U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approval to treat major depressive disorder with Caplyta.
- The approval expands Caplyta beyond schizophrenia and bipolar depression.
- The move follows Johnson & Johnson's $14.6 billion acquisition of Intra-Cellular Therapies, the developer of Caplyta.
- Caplyta shows 80% response and 65% remission.
- Caplyta generated $240 million in sales in the third quarter and is being studied for other neurological disorders.
